Output 66586e99de8d35eaadbdf058258c06b34211ba1aa7338bf10c01eaaffe7bffae:0

value
9024711
script pubkey
OP_0 OP_PUSHBYTES_20 b9f9bee11c90a83ed4be740525eaadd2a996fba0
address
bc1qh8umacgujz5ra497wszjt64d625ed7aq2tjaz8
transaction
66586e99de8d35eaadbdf058258c06b34211ba1aa7338bf10c01eaaffe7bffae
confirmations
169419
spent
true